Next problem was the Quickshifter, it stopped working on the upshifts. I removed it, cleaned it did everything and it just wouldn’t work. So Ducati Glasgow came and collected the bike and took it away. It was away for quite a while, they replaced the switch with a brand new updated switch and then brought it back. From that point to the time I sold it back to them it never played up again.

The sense of occasion with the bike was special, the only downside which didn’t apply to me as I do all my own work anyway is the scaremongering that Ducati dealers do with regards to working on them, it’s all relative, if you are mechanically minded then it’s fair game especially when the service costs are silly for the Desmo service, the hourly rate these places charge is ridiculous. If anything find a local mechanic/garage and have them do the work.
It munches tyres for fun but depends where you live and the kind of roads you ride on, I went through a spell of heading up towards Fort William and Oban almost every night over a two week period and it destroyed a rear tyre purely because of the long straights, especially on the section between Lix Toll and Tyndrum but since then that stretch of road has been fitted with average speed cameras.
